Transaction 62ec53248b50e91cdbceea28d3eb65e5e5af94c6c0fd296f291494cf6a487706

100 Input
1 Outputs
  • 62ec53248b50e91cdbceea28d3eb65e5e5af94c6c0fd296f291494cf6a487706:0
  • value  345575681
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h